7 Kebabs By The Street In Delhi

on

You can grill, bake and fry them but you just cannot have enough of kebabs! The dish is probably the best legacy left behind by the royals of the gone eras and by far the most delicious gift from the Central Asian countries. We love it on a plated platter and we can kill for the ones by the street! Here are 7 street side joints in Delhi that have got some excellent meats and veggies smoking on the skewers.

 

  1. Ustad Moinuddin Kebabs

This legendary kebab place stands tall and proud round the corner of Gali Qasimjan. Famous for its juicy and fresh kebabs by Ustad Moinuddin the place thrives with ardent meat fans.chapli_kabab1

 

  1. Qureshi’s Kabab Corner

Dive into some mouthwatering Mughlai delicacies at Qureshi’s. The place brings to you the best tandoori tikkas and kebabs cooked and spiced to perfection. Although the joint offers a fair variety of veggies, the place would be more enjoyable for a carnivore.kebab

Get your palate all greased up with the disgustingly decadent shami kebabs here. The place opens up in the late afternoon hours (4.30PM), which give you enough time to skip a lot of meals.Mangal Kebab

Loved for its excellent kakoris, Majeed’s knows its meat an the perfectly spiced, mint infused, succulent kakori kebabs stand proof of that.kebabs

Situated on Mathura Road near Pragati Maidan, the Matka Pir has a modest little eatery behind the mosque. Binge on their melt-in-the-mouth galoutis while you get a portion of skewered mutton seekh packed for home.seekh kebab

Another hot spot for mean kakoris, Alkauser does only deliveries and takeaways. Put your finger on their wide range of grilled tikkas, tandoori delights and mind numbing kakori and let Alkauser tell you what perfection is!b70dd355ca22c20943bcb4241ba4bdfc_1449293993

Stuff yourself with butter-smothered naans, smoky tikkas and par excellent galoutis as you praise the tandoors and tawas at this legendary dhaba in Safdarjung.kebabs
